select the correct answer. on what interval is the function h(x) = |x - 5| + 2 increasing? a. (2, ∞) b. (5, ∞) c. (-∞, 2) d. (-∞, 5)
Answer
Explanation:
Step1: Rewrite absolute - value function
The absolute - value function (y = |x - 5|) can be rewritten as a piece - wise function: (y=\begin{cases}x - 5, & x\geq5\-(x - 5), & x<5\end{cases}). So, (h(x)=\begin{cases}x - 5+2=x - 3, & x\geq5\-(x - 5)+2=-x + 7, & x<5\end{cases}).
Step2: Analyze the slope of each part
For (h(x)=x - 3) when (x\geq5), the slope (m = 1>0), which means the function is increasing on the interval ([5,\infty)). For (h(x)=-x + 7) when (x<5), the slope (m=-1<0), which means the function is decreasing on the interval ((-\infty,5)).
Answer:
B. ((5,\infty))
